THE JAPANESE TREATY.

AUSTRALIAN LABOUR VIEWS,

By Telegraph—Prass Association-Copyrieh* Melbourne, July 18. > The Acting Federal Prime Minister (Mr. W. M. Hushes) declared that the new treaty was the most significant factor in the Empire's defence problem. He hoped that tho new scope of tho arbitration treaties would be extended to cover other countries. Sydney, July 18. Mr. W. A. Holman, Acting State Premier, considers that the AngloJapanese Treaty effectually disposes of the yellow peril scare, which he personally regarded as without foundation. He trusted that venomous journals would cease attempting to stir up international hostility. ENGLISH PRESS COMMENT. (Rec. July 18, 10.40 p.m.) London, July 18. Tho newspapers note with satisfaction the approval of the Commonwealth and the other Dominions of the renewal of tho Japanese Alliance, and particularly tho introduction of the new clauso relating to general arbitration.

They also note Franco's gratification at a step which will strengthen tho hands of Britain's friends, and the St. Petersburg journal "Novoe Vremya's" applause of the omission of the clauso relating to countries adjacent to tho Indian frontier, and its further advocacy of a general arbitration treaty between Russia and Great Britain.
